The extensions can be specified by makedumpfile cmdline parameter as
"--extension", followed by extension's filename or absolute path. If
filename is give, then "./", "./extenisons" and
"/usr/lib64/makedumpfile/extensions/" will be searched.

The procedures of extensions are as follows:

Step 0: Every extensions will declare which kernel symbol/types they needed
during programming. This info will be stored within .init_ksyms/ktypes section.
Also extension will have a callback function for makedumpfile to call.

Step 1: Register .init_ksyms and .init_ktypes sections of makedumpfile
itself and extension's .so files, then tell kallsyms/btf subcomponent that which
kernel symbols/types will be resolved. And callbacks are also registered.

Step 2: Init kernel/module's btf/kallsyms on demand. Any un-needed kenrel
modules will be skipped.

Step 3: During btf/kallsyms parsing, the needed info will be filled. For
syms/types which are defined via INIT_MOD_OPT(...) macro, these are optinal
syms/types, it won't fail at parsing step if any are missing, instead, they
need to be checked within extension_init() of each extensions; Otherwise for
syms/types which defined via INIT_MOD(...) macro, these are must-have syms/types,
if any missing, the extension will fail at this step and as a result
this extension will be skipped.

After this step, required kernel symbol value and kernel types size/offset
are resolved, the extensions are ready to go.

Step 4: When makedumpfile doing page filtering, in addition to its
original filtering mechanism, it will call extensions callbacks for advices
whether the page should be included/excluded.

+/*
+ * For a single pfn/pcache, multiple extensions will decide whether to:
+ * 1) include the page (PG_INCLUDE), or
+ * 2) exclude the page (PG_EXCLUDE), or
+ * 3) make no decision to pass to others or fallback to traditional page-flags
+ *    based filtering (PG_UNDECID).
+ * 
+ * The arbitration is:
+ * 1) Include the page if anyone says PG_INCLUDE, and
+ * 2) Exclude the page if no one says PG_INCLUDE, but one or more say PG_EXCLUDE.
+ */
+int run_extension_callback(unsigned long pfn, const void *pcache)
+{
+	int result;
+	int ret = PG_UNDECID;
+
+	for (int i = 0; i < handle_cbs_len; i++) {
+		if (handle_cbs[i]->cb) {
+			result = handle_cbs[i]->cb(pfn, pcache);
+			if (result == PG_INCLUDE) {
+				ret = result;
+				goto out;
+			} else if (result == PG_EXCLUDE) {
+				ret = result;
+			}
+		}
+	}
+out:
+	return ret;
+}
